Workflow Statuses
Workflow statuses are the columns tickets move through on the board. You can rename, add, and reorder them for each workspace.
The default flow
Out of the box every workspace has four statuses, shown as lanes on the board:
- Open: new, not started
- Work in Progress: actively being worked
- Waiting: blocked, usually on the customer or a third party
- Closed: done
Customizing statuses
Go to Settings → Workflow Statuses. From there you can:
- Add a status (e.g. "In Review", "Approved"), it becomes a new board column
- Rename an existing status
- Reorder statuses to set the left-to-right flow on the board
- Mark which statuses count as open vs resolved/closed for reporting and SLA purposes
Statuses are per workspace, so different teams can run different flows. See workspaces for how that isolation works.
Transitions
Beyond the list of statuses, you can define transitions: which moves between statuses are allowed, and what happens on the way. Under Settings → Transitions you control the path tickets take (for example, requiring a ticket to pass through "In Review" before "Closed"), and which statuses prompt for a resolution type when a ticket is closed.
